Overview
This position is responsible for the installation, maintenance, troubleshooting, and repair of facility machinery.
Job Responsibilities
Install facility machinery.
Perform preventative and predictive maintenance on facility machinery.
Troubleshoot and repair facility machinery.
Write and maintain standard operating procedures (SOPs) and Job Safety Analysis (JSAs).
Complete daily maintenance and repair logs.
• Communicate with operators from other shifts. • Maintain and secure work tools.
Clean and maintain work area.

Safety/Health
Maintenance Mechanics are required to work safely, follow all safety rules and procedures, attend all safety meetings, report unsafe conditions to Leaders at once, and keep all tools and equipment in safe working condition. They will also be encouraged to read and ask questions about safety materials such as Safety Data Sheets (SDS), Job Safety Analysis (JSA), Job Safety Information (JSI), and know where to find them. Additionally, Mechanics will need to maintain clean and orderly work areas and offer suggestions and seek answers concerning safety issues.
Work Environment
Working conditions are normal for a chemical manufacturing environment. Candidate must be comfortable working around chemicals such as Herbicides and Insecticides. Work involves stooping, bending, kneeling, reaching overhead, and lifting of materials up to 50 pounds. Will be required to climb ladders and stairs and perform work in and on elevated areas such as roofs and dust collectors. Ability to work outdoors in adverse conditions as necessa1y. Machinery and tool operation requires the use of safety equipment to include but not limited to; safety goggles, respirators, hearing protection, work boots, and hardhats.
Qualifications
Journeyman certificate in associated trade required.
Advanced skill required in one or more of the following areas: HVAC, electrical, mechanical, hydraulic & pneumatic systems, plumbing, carpent1y, and piping systems.
Ability to read and interpret blueprints and schematics.
Problem-solving skills
Ability to work independently and in a team environment
Manual dexterity required for operating machinery and computers.
Ability to lift up to 50 pounds required.
Proficient in all aspects of welding preferred
Basic skills in operating lathes, mills, presses and brakes.
Safely operate all hand tools.
